Faculty

Meet Your Instructors

Every Omnia Academy course is designed and delivered by practitioners recognised in their field, not a training provider once removed from practice.

Dr Palitha Serasinghe

Dr Palitha Serasinghe

Ayurveda Consultant, Omnia Lifestyle

President, British Ayurvedic Medical Council · Principal Lecturer, College of Ayurveda (UK) & College of Ayurveda, Japan

Over 30 years as an Ayurvedic teacher and practitioner, having taught up to postgraduate level across Sri Lanka, Japan and the UK. A published researcher and long-standing member of several professional Ayurvedic bodies.

Dr Jency Babu

Dr Jency Babu

Clinic Lead – Lifestyle, Omnia Lifestyle

Clinic Lead for Lifestyle, shaping Omnia's integrated Ayurveda, yoga and preventive health programmes

A research-driven, preventive-medicine approach spanning women's health, MSK conditions and stress management, with published work on yoga's role in managing lower back pain.

Dr Deepa Apte

Dr Deepa Apte

Consultant, Omnia Lifestyle

Founder, Ayurveda Pura Academy, London · Consultant, Omnia Lifestyle

An award-winning educator who has trained thousands of students and healthcare professionals worldwide through internationally recognised diploma programmes and professional development courses.

FAQ

Questions Before You Register

Do these courses carry CPD credits?

Per-course CPD credit values will be confirmed and published ahead of launch.

Are the courses accredited?

Yoga Teacher Training is accredited through Yoga Alliance Professionals. Accreditation for the Ayurvedic courses is TBC and will be confirmed and published before launch.

Can I start without a prior qualification in this discipline?

It depends on the course. Some are open entry, others require a professional background or a prior qualification within that discipline, as noted on each course card. Ayurvedic Therapist Level 1 is open entry, while the PG Certificate and Advanced Ayurvedic Therapist require a healthcare background or prior Ayurvedic qualification.

How does hybrid delivery work?

The split between online and in-person sessions, and the location of in-person sessions, is TBC and will be confirmed per course.
